About Cwrt Y Cadno

Cwrt Y Cadno is a beautifully restored barn conversion in Llangyndeyrn, Carmarthenshire. This spacious property sits in quiet countryside six miles from Carmarthen. The private hot tub overlooks neighbouring fields and provides a perfect spot to unwind after exploring West Wales.

The location puts you within easy reach of Pembrey Country Park, Llansteffan and Ferryside beaches to the south. Visit The Dylan Thomas Boathouse in Laugharne, the National Botanic Garden of Wales or Aberglasney Gardens. Ffos Las racecourse is also nearby.

The property sleeps eight guests across four bedrooms. The ground floor double has French windows opening onto the patio. Upstairs you'll find a stylish double with TV and en-suite shower room, plus another double and a twin room. Three bathrooms serve the property including two shower rooms and one main bathroom with bath.

The spacious kitchen-diner leads to a generously-sized lounge with comfortable sofas and patio doors to the garden. Welcome gifts include chilled Prosecco, milk and Welsh cakes.

Frequently Asked Questions

Quick answers to our most common questions about Cwrt Y Cadno

Does this cottage have a hot tub?
Yes, Cwrt Y Cadno has a private hot tub located in the enclosed patio garden. The hot tub is well maintained and offers lovely views over the surrounding fields.
Is it pet friendly?
Yes, this property welcomes up to two dogs. Your pets can enjoy the enclosed patio garden and the surrounding Carmarthenshire countryside walks.
How many guests does Cwrt Y Cadno sleep?
The barn conversion sleeps eight guests across four bedrooms. There are three doubles (one on the ground floor) and one twin room on the first floor.
What bathroom facilities are available?
The property has three bathrooms in total. These include a ground floor shower room, a first floor bathroom with bath and shower and an en-suite shower room attached to one double bedroom.
Is there parking at the property?
Yes, on-site parking is provided at Cwrt Y Cadno. You'll have convenient off-road parking available throughout your stay.
What kitchen facilities are provided?
The spacious kitchen-diner includes an oven, hob, microwave and fridge-freezer. There's also a separate utility room with dishwasher, washing machine and tumble dryer.
Is there a downstairs bedroom and bathroom?
Yes, there's a ground floor double bedroom with French windows to the patio. A ground floor shower room with WC is also available for added convenience.
What outdoor space is available?
The property has an enclosed patio garden with furniture and a barbecue. The private hot tub sits in this garden area with views across neighbouring fields.
